Choose aggregate crushing equipment

Aggregate crushing equipment is essential in the construction industry for processing materials like gravel, sand, and crushed stone into usable products for various applications such as road construction, foundation work, and concrete production. Selecting the right equipment is crucial for efficient and cost-effective operations. Let’s explore some key factors to consider when choosing aggregate crushing equipment:

  1. Type of Material: Understand the type and properties of the material to be crushed. Different materials require different crushing methods and equipment. For instance, softer materials like limestone may be crushed using compression crushers, while harder materials like granite may require impact crushers.
  2. Production Capacity: Determine the required production capacity to meet project demands. Crushing equipment comes in various sizes and capacities, ranging from small machines suitable for small-scale operations to large crushers capable of handling high volumes of material.
  3. Size Reduction Ratio: Consider the desired size reduction ratio, which is the ratio of the feed size to the product size after crushing. This ratio affects the efficiency of the crushing process and the quality of the final product. Different types of crushers offer different size reduction ratios, so choose equipment that can achieve the desired output size.
  4. Crushing Stages: Decide whether a single-stage or multi-stage crushing process is needed. Single-stage crushing involves reducing the material to the desired size in one step, while multi-stage crushing involves multiple stages of crushing to achieve the final product size. The choice depends on factors such as the size of the feed material and the required product specifications.
  5. Energy Efficiency: Look for equipment that offers high energy efficiency to minimize operating costs and reduce environmental impact. Modern crushers often feature advanced technologies such as hydraulic systems and variable speed drives that optimize energy consumption.
  6. Maintenance Requirements: Consider the maintenance requirements of the equipment, including ease of access for servicing and availability of spare parts. Choose equipment from reputable manufacturers known for quality construction and reliable performance to minimize downtime and maintenance costs.
  7. Mobility: If the crushing operation requires mobility, such as in mining or road construction projects, consider mobile crushing equipment that can be easily transported between job sites. Mobile crushers offer flexibility and convenience, allowing operators to move the equipment as needed to access different areas.
